Setting Up a Comfortable Video Chat Space

Before you hit “call,” create an environment that puts both you and your match at ease. A well‑prepared setting signals respect and seriousness.

Practical Tips for a Perfect Setup

  • Choose a quiet room – Background noise distracts and can make you sound rushed.
  • Mind the lighting – Natural light from a window works best; avoid harsh backlighting.
  • Check your tech – Test the webcam and microphone a day before the call.
  • Keep the background tidy – A clean space reflects a clear mind.

A calm, well‑lit room helps you focus on the conversation rather than technical glitches.

The First Video Call: What to Say and What to Watch

A successful video chat balances conversation flow with attentive observation. Here’s a simple roadmap for your inaugural call.

Conversation Flow

Phase Goal Sample Prompt
Warm‑up Break the ice “I love the garden behind you – is that a hobby of yours?”
Discovery Learn interests “What’s a book you’ve read recently that stayed with you?”
Connection Find common ground “I also enjoy cooking; what’s your favorite recipe?”
Close Set next step “Would you like to meet for a walk in the park this weekend?”

Non‑Verbal Cues to Notice

  • Eye contact – Direct gaze shows interest.
  • Facial expressions – A genuine smile often means comfort.
  • Body posture – Leaning slightly forward signals engagement.

If you notice your match’s eyes darting or a forced smile, it may be a red flag. Trust your instincts and remember you can always end the call politely.

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them

Even seasoned daters can slip up during video chats. Below is a quick bullet list of pitfalls and the easy fixes.

  • Talking too fast – Slow down; pause for reactions.
  • Multitasking – Close other tabs; give full attention.
  • Ignoring background – Keep the space tidy; it reflects you.
  • Skipping the test run – Always test equipment beforehand.
  • Over‑sharing too soon – Keep early topics light; deeper talks come later.

By staying aware of these habits, you’ll project confidence and respect.

Advanced Techniques for a Deeper Connection

Once you’re comfortable with basic video calls, you can add a few extra touches that elevate the experience.

  1. Use a shared activity – Cook the same simple recipe together while on video.
  2. Play a quick game – A short trivia round can reveal humor and knowledge.
  3. Virtual tour – Show a favorite spot in your home, like a bookshelf or garden, and ask them to share theirs.

These interactive ideas turn a standard chat into a memorable date.
